Why Retail Buyers Order Corrugated Shipping Displays for Retail

Retail buyers do not order corrugated shipping displays for retail just because they need a box with graphics. They buy them because the display has to do three jobs at once: protect product in transit, present product in store, and reduce labor at receiving. That combination is hard to beat, especially when a retailer is paying store labor rates of $17 to $24 an hour in places like California, Illinois, and New York.

At shelf level, displays are judged in seconds. A shopper walks up, glances, and decides whether the item feels easy to buy. If the display looks unstable, if the lid bows, or if the graphics are muddy, the brand loses trust before the product gets touched. I watched this play out at a regional beauty chain in Phoenix where two nearly identical displays were tested beside each other. The version with cleaner print and a simpler front-opening panel converted better even though the product inside was the same. Retail can be brutally literal like that, and a 1.5 mm misalignment can look far bigger than it is.

One well-built unit can serve as both a shipper and a display. That cuts down on repacking, shrink wrap, and store labor. It also shortens the path from distribution center to selling floor. In practical terms, that means fewer touchpoints, lower damage risk, and less dimensional weight wasted on secondary cartons that never see a customer. Compared with rigid fixtures, corrugated options usually cost less to freight, store, and update. A metal or plastic fixture may last longer, but it also demands warehouse space and often a bigger capital budget. Corrugated shipping display programs are easier to reset with seasonal art, retailer-specific messaging, or private-label changes. That flexibility matters when a brand needs to move fast without tying up cash in long-life fixtures. One honest caveat: a corrugated display is not the right answer for every item. If the product is extremely heavy, reusable for years, or exposed to rough shopper abuse day after day, a molded or rigid fixture may make more sense. Corrugated wins when speed, flexibility, and freight efficiency matter most.

Order Corrugated Shipping Displays for Retail: Product Types and Build Options

When buyers order corrugated shipping displays for retail, they usually start with one of six formats: PDQ trays, shelf-ready shippers, floor displays, dump bins, sidekick displays, and pallet-ready units. Each one behaves differently on the retail floor, and each one has a sweet spot depending on whether the product weighs 3 ounces or 15 pounds.

Common display formats and where they work best

  • PDQ trays: Best for small, fast-moving items such as cosmetics, travel accessories, batteries, and candy. They usually hold 6 to 24 units and are easy to drop onto a shelf. A typical tray might use 350gsm C1S artboard laminated to E-flute for a crisp retail edge.
  • Shelf-ready shippers: Good for warehouse clubs, grocery, and mass retail where the case converts into a display with a tear strip or removable front panel. Many programs use B-flute or E-flute corrugate, depending on the load and retailer handling rules.
  • Floor displays: Strong choice for seasonal launches, mid-size products, and items that need more visual space. These often include a header card, a reinforced base, and a 24-inch to 48-inch footprint.
  • Dump bins: Useful for promotions, clearance, and loose-pack goods. They create a high-volume presentation, though they can look messy if the product is too light or irregular. A 30-inch diameter bin can work well for small toys, accessories, or overstock resets.
  • Sidekick displays: Ideal for checkout lanes and narrow aisle space. I’ve seen these used effectively for accessories, trial sizes, and impulse items, especially in stores with only 8 to 10 inches of shelf depth at the register.
  • Pallet-ready units: Built to ride directly on a pallet and convert on the sales floor with minimal handling. They make sense for heavier loads or club-channel programs, particularly when a 48 x 40-inch footprint is already part of the receiving plan.

The right format starts with product weight, retail environment, and replenishment frequency. A 2-ounce packaged snack and a 5-pound countertop appliance should never share the same structure, even if the artwork looks good on screen. One needs a lightweight tray. The other needs load-bearing support, maybe double-wall corrugate, and a better base design that can handle 40 to 60 pounds without deflection.

Structure matters as much as graphics. Single-wall corrugate is common for lighter displays, especially if the product is already in a retail-ready carton. Double-wall becomes important when the unit carries more weight, travels farther, or stacks under pressure. I’ve seen double-wall save a program when a distributor in Memphis insisted on pallet stacking six high in a humid warehouse. The cheaper option would have failed after the first receiving cycle. I’m still a little annoyed on behalf of the earlier spec that got ignored.

Design features can make or break the display. Die-cut supports keep the tray from sagging. Inserts prevent bottles or cartons from shifting during transit. Tear strips help the store open the unit without a box cutter. Removable lids protect product during shipping and convert into a clean display face. These are not cosmetic extras. They are shipping materials that affect breakage, labor, and presentation. A 5-cent insert can save a $200 return.

Print choices also change the outcome. One-color graphics can work for price-point items and private-label programs. Full-color print usually raises perceived value, especially if the display sits at eye level or on an endcap. Inside and outside printing can help when the top panel is visible in transit or when the retailer wants brand reinforcement after opening. If you order corrugated shipping displays for retail, ask how much of the display will actually be seen by shoppers. There is no reason to print premium coverage on a panel that disappears inside the shipper, especially if the unit is sealed in a backroom for 14 days before store delivery.

I learned that during a supplier negotiation for a beverage promo in Charlotte. The buyer wanted full coverage on every panel, but the display spent 80% of its life stacked in a backroom or moving through order fulfillment. We trimmed print coverage, kept the front and header strong, and saved nearly 14% on the run. The brand still looked polished where it mattered. That kind of compromise is not glamorous, but it is smart.

If your display has to perform in a humid environment, near freezers, or in a high-touch aisle, ask about moisture-resistant coatings and board selection. Not every program needs them. For refrigerated retail, damp receiving docks, or long transit lanes, the wrong paperboard can curl, crush, or scuff faster than you expect. Specifications That Matter Before You Place an Order

If you order corrugated shipping displays for retail without clear specs, you invite delays and redesigns. The basics are simple, but they need to be precise: product dimensions, gross weight, count per display, carton style, flute type, board grade, and load capacity. A few millimeters can matter, especially in a shelf-ready case where the retail opening has to match the product carton exactly. A display spec that is off by 4 mm can change the whole production run.

Buyers often send only the item size. That is not enough. I need the packed product size, because retail-ready packaging changes the footprint. A pump bottle in a tray behaves differently from a shrink-wrapped carton. If the display is meant to hold 12 units across two rows, the gap between units, the support points, and the front lip all need to be set against the finished pack, not just the naked product. Otherwise, you end up discovering the problem after the prototype is made, which is a very expensive way to learn geometry.

Environmental conditions matter too. Ask where the display will live: floor, shelf, pallet, endcap, or checkout. Ask how far it will travel from the converter in Ohio to a distribution center in Pennsylvania. Ask whether it will sit in a humid DC for 10 days before store delivery. Ask if it will be stacked. I’ve seen a simple single-wall display pass a short local route and fail after a cross-country lane because the board absorbed too much moisture in transit packaging. Same design. Different reality.

Dimensional tolerances are another place where small errors become expensive. If the spec is off by 3 to 5 mm, a store associate may struggle to open the unit, or the product may rattle inside the tray. That can lead to scuffing, crushed corners, or a display that looks sloppy on the floor. In retail, sloppy costs more than it seems. A display that is 2 mm too tight can slow a store reset by several minutes per unit across hundreds of locations, which adds up quickly when 700 stores are involved.

For performance and compliance, I ask buyers to think about ISTA-style transit protection, print durability, and retail-ready case pack expectations. Packaging testing standards such as the guidance on ISTA help verify that a shipper can survive vibration, compression, and drops before it reaches the store. Before you order corrugated shipping displays for retail, send these items together:

  • Final packed product dimensions in inches or millimeters
  • Gross weight and unit count per display
  • Retail footprint, shelf size, or pallet footprint
  • Product sample or a filled carton sample
  • Artwork files in vector format
  • Retailer planogram or fixture drawing
  • Any compliance requirements, such as FSC or test standards

The best briefs are not long. They are complete. If you send enough detail up front, the structure is easier to engineer, the quote is more accurate, and the likelihood of revision drops fast. Pricing, MOQ, and What Changes Your Quote

Price is where many buyers get surprised, especially when they order corrugated shipping displays for retail for the first time. The quote is shaped by board grade, color count, size, structural complexity, quantity, finishing, and whether the run needs any special tooling. Two displays that look similar on paper can differ by 30% or more if one uses a simple die-cut tray and the other has inserts, tabs, and multi-component supports.

For a rough benchmark, a small shelf-ready display in a 5,000-piece run might land around $0.38 to $0.82 per unit, while a larger floor display could run $0.95 to $2.40 per unit depending on board grade and print coverage. A pallet-ready unit often costs more because it carries more weight and uses heavier construction. These are not universal figures. They are planning numbers. I always tell clients that the final quote depends on how much load the display must carry and how much shelf presence they want. For example, a 350gsm C1S artboard insert paired with B-flute can behave very differently from a plain single-wall tray.

The minimum order quantity, or MOQ, depends on tooling and print method. A simple one-color run can sometimes be made in smaller numbers than a full-color program with complex finishing. Smaller quantities usually raise unit cost. That is the tradeoff: lower commitment versus higher per-piece pricing. What changes the quote most?

  • Board strength: E-flute, B-flute, C-flute, or double-wall material
  • Graphic coverage: one-color versus full-color print
  • Construction complexity: inserts, tabs, lids, tear strips, or glued panels
  • Quantity: larger runs usually lower unit cost
  • Coatings: moisture resistance, gloss, matte, or soft-touch finishes
  • Freight method: pallet shipping versus expedited delivery
  • Rush timing: shorter schedules often add cost

Prototype and sample costs are usually separate from production. A flat sample might cost $85 to $250 depending on design complexity, and a structural prototype can be higher if tooling is required. That sample is not just a nice-to-have. It prevents expensive production errors. In one client meeting in Seattle, I watched a team approve a beautifully rendered display from a PDF alone. The prototype revealed that the product carton sat 6 mm too tall for the lid. They saved themselves from a useless 20,000-piece run. That is the kind of mistake that turns a “quick approval” into a long, awkward silence.

Hidden cost variables show up more often than buyers expect. Custom inserts add material and assembly time. Multi-SKU displays increase setup complexity because the layout must keep each product facing the right direction. Specialty coatings can improve retail appearance but add process steps. Rushed production compresses scheduling, and that can affect labor and freight. If you order corrugated shipping displays for retail, ask for quote tiers at 1,000, 5,000, and 10,000 units. That is where the real break point appears. A run priced at $0.15 per unit for 5,000 pieces can jump meaningfully if you add a matte aqueous coating and barcode panel.

Process and Timeline for Retail Display Orders

The order flow is straightforward if the information is complete. First comes discovery, then spec review, structural design, artwork prep, sample approval, production, and shipment. If you order corrugated shipping displays for retail and your team has final dimensions ready, the whole process moves much faster. A clean brief from Los Angeles or Philadelphia can save nearly a week of back-and-forth.

Timeline depends on design complexity, proofing speed, material availability, and the number of revision rounds. A simple tray with one-color print can move quickly. A full-color floor display with inserts and a specialty coating will take longer. The difference is not just manufacturing time. It is also the time spent checking fit, print position, and retail conversion features. A two-panel shipper with no inserts can be approved in days; a six-component pallet unit may need a sample roundtrip.

The fastest schedules are usually not won in production. They are won in approval. If the artwork is finalized, the dieline is signed off, and the retailer’s footprint is confirmed, you save days. If feedback arrives in fragments, the calendar stretches. I’ve watched a 12-business-day plan turn into 21 because three departments each sent a different logo file. Retailers often build around launch dates, reset windows, and distribution center receiving schedules. That means your display timeline has to align with store timing, not just vendor timing. If the campaign is tied to a spring reset, the display may need to arrive two to three weeks early so the DC can stage it, allocate it, and ship on schedule. Late delivery often hurts more than a slightly higher price because the promo window is gone. In practical terms, a display arriving on April 28 for a May 1 reset is useful; one arriving May 8 is not.

  1. Discovery — confirm product size, retail channel, and launch date.
  2. Spec review — choose structure, board grade, and print method.
  3. Artwork prep — align logos, barcodes, and retailer requirements.
  4. Prototype — validate fit and conversion features.
  5. Approval — sign off on sample, color, and final dieline.
  6. Production — print, die-cut, glue, pack, and inspect.
  7. Shipment — palletize and send to DC or co-packer.

Typical lead times vary by complexity, but a simple production run might take 12 to 15 business days from proof approval, while a more complex retail display program can take 18 to 30 business days. That depends on board availability and whether tooling is already in place. I would rather give a realistic range than a shiny promise that collapses halfway through the project.
